Centre Manager Automotive

Location: Aberystwyth

Salary: £35,000 basic + £10,000 bonus

Working Hours:
Monday to Friday: 8:30am to 5:00pm, 1 in 2 Saturdays: 8:30am to 4:00pm, Day off in the week when working Saturdays


We are currently recruiting for an experienced Centre Manager to join a well-established automotive fast-fit business in the Aberystwyth area. This is an excellent opportunity for a proven leader from a fast-fit / automotive service background to take full responsibility for a busy, high-performing site.

What’s on Offer:

  • Competitive basic salary £35,000
  • Bonus potential up to £10,000
  • Stable, well-established business
  • Opportunity to lead a busy and successful site
  • Career progression opportunities
  • Financial Incentives: Performance bonuses, employee discounts on tyres/MOTs, and retail vouchers
  • Professional Growth: Fully funded Institute of the Motor Industry (IMI) training courses
  • Perks & Wellbeing: Life insurance, pension, cycle-to-work scheme, and enhanced maternity/paternity leave.

The Role:

The role focuses on delivering key business objectives by managing everyday depot operations, building a positive sales culture, and ensuring high service standards.

  • Managing the daily operations of the centre to achieve business targets
  • Delivering outstanding customer service and maintaining high standards
  • Leading, motivating, and developing a team of technicians and front-of-house staff
  • Driving sales performance and maximising revenue opportunities
  • Ensuring full compliance with Health & Safety regulations
  • Managing stock control, costs, and overall centre profitability
  • Monitoring performance and implementing improvements where needed

This aligns with the core focus of the role around customer excellence, financial performance, operational control, and people management.

Requirements:

  • Previous experience as a Centre Manager / Assistant Manager within a fast-fit or automotive environment
  • Strong leadership and team management skills
  • Proven track record in a sales-driven environment
  • Good technical/mechanical understanding
  • Commercial awareness with the ability to drive performance
  • Excellent customer service and communication skills
